I now have approx 15k gold in my bank, with about 2000 IoS. Glyphing has been the primary source of my income so far, bringing in a steady 500g minimum a day. Nothing really new in glyphing these days. Herbs are selling ridiculously low at 8g a stack, and there isn't any real campers on the AH right now (crosses fingers). Just the usual people who post a few times a day. The old AH campers seemed to have vanished, probably cause the promise of quick gold didn't happen. I have also been dabbling in the scrolling market these days as well. I was a little weary of going into this market just because I was thinking: well people can get these mats for dirt cheap now, why would they want to spend 200g on something that would cost them 50g? Especially with all the enchanters these days giving away enchants for free. However, I was wrong!!! Maybe people are just lazy, or stupid, but I constantly sell enchants, that cost me roughly 50g to 100g to make, for 100g to 400g. The profit from enchanting scrolls is staggering. Not to mention no AH costs to list scrolls, so you can camp to your hearts content! Anyways, thats all I have to say for now.
